Cloudera Developer for Hadoop & Spark I

Inscreva-se

Sobre este Curso

O Developer for Apache Hadoop & Spark I é um treinamento de 32 horas dividido em 4 dias de 8 horas cada que capacita profissionais de TI e de desenvolvimento a utilizar o Hadoop e todas as suas principais features de armazenamento (HDFS) e processamento de informações (Apache Spark) em larga escala.


Qual é o programa completo do curso?

  • Introdução
  • A motivação pelo Hadoop
  • Conceitos Básicos para se escrever um programa Spark
  • Testando Programas Spark
  • Conhecendo profundamente a API do Spark
  • Dicas práticas de desenvolvimento e técnicas
  • Entrada e saída de dados
  • Algoritmos comuns de Spark
  • Fazendo Joins em Conjuntos de Dados em Spark e Spark SQL
  • Integrando o Spark no workflow da empresa
  • Machine Learning e Spark
  • Introdução ao Hive e Impala
  • Conclusão

O que vou aprender?

  • As tecnologias core do Hadoop
  • Como o Hadoop Distributed File System e o Spark funcionam
  • Como desenvolver aplicativos Spark
  • Como fazer testes em aplicações Spark
  • Melhores práticas para desenvolver e fazer debug de aplicativos Spark
  • Como implementar saída e entrada de dados em aplicações Spark
  • Algoritmos comuns para tarefas Spark
  • Como fazer um Join com dados em Spark SQL
  • Como o Hadoop e Spark se integram ao Data Center
  • Como usar os algoritmos de Machine Learning com Spark
  • Como o Hive e o Impala podem ser usados para desenvolvimento rápido de queries

Formas de Pagamento

  • Pagamento parcelado sem juros no cartão de crédito;
  • Para empresas, aceitamos transferência bancária ou boleto com emissão de nota fiscal eletrônica;
  • Descontos especiais para grupos.

Carga Horária

  • 4 dias de 8 horas cada, totalizando 32 horas de treinamento
    *Treinamento sujeito a confirmação.

Idioma


Para quem esse curso é indicado?

Esse curso é indicado para desenvolvedores que irão escrever e manter processos de Big Data usando o Hadoop como meio de armazenamento e processamento de dados em larga escala, com grande volume de dados e variedade, e com ganhas de velocidade no processamento e no tempo de resposta e ação a partir de dados.

Administradores de Banco de Dados também podem se beneficiar do curso.

Conhecimento de Java é importante, mas não obrigatório. Conhecimento de uma linguagem de programação é extremamente importante.


Inscreva-se